Output 9146f6e78ea1fe97edb49f11266f52ca72d5f99ab6a30a740f3e428205f1676e:0

value
636900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4325e298eeec8bf8beae0d463d749d61c686b07 OP_EQUAL
address
3KaQhm3HH1jFmHrCvwCd7obnhaja6Ft3qw
transaction
9146f6e78ea1fe97edb49f11266f52ca72d5f99ab6a30a740f3e428205f1676e
spent
true